Completed in 1806, the Fourth Symphony was conceived at the end of an astonishingly productive period in Beethoven's career (1804-1806). The same important span of time in which he wrote the Fourth Piano Concerto, the "Appassionata" Sonata, and the three Razumovsky string quartets, it was a period of stylistic authority and perfection of the "symphonic ideal."
